How to Make Nutella Puff Pastries
Quick Overview
Nutella Puff Pastries are effortless, delicious, and delightfully satisfying. With minimal preparation and a mere 15-20 minutes in the oven, you’ll have desserts that look and taste gourmet without the fuss. Let’s get to it!
Key Ingredients for Nutella Puff Pastries:
- 1 sheet of puff pastry, thawed
- 1 cup of Nutella
- 1 egg (for egg wash)
- Powdered sugar (optional for dusting)

Step-by-Step Instructions:
- Preheat the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). This ensures your pastries puff up perfectly!
- Prepare the Puff Pastry: Roll out the thawed puff pastry on a lightly floured surface to improve its texture.
- Cut into Squares: Slice the pastry into squares, approximately 4 inches by 4 inches. You should get about 6-8 squares depending on the pastry size.
- Fill with Nutella: Take a spoonful of Nutella and place it in the center of each pastry square. Leave a little space around the edges.
- Seal the Pastries: Fold over the pastry diagonally to form a triangle, then press the edges together with your fingers or a fork to seal it tightly.
- Egg Wash: Beat the egg in a bowl and brush it over the tops of the pastries for that golden finish.
- Bake: Place the pastries on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per, then bake for 15-20 minutes or until they’re puffed and golden.
- Cool and Enjoy: Allow the pastries to cool slightly before serving. For an extra touch, dust with powdered sugar.

Top Tips for Perfecting Nutella Puff Pastries
- Don’t Overfill: It can be tempting to add a lot of Nutella, but less is more! Too much filling can lead to messy pastries that won’t seal properly.
- Chill Between Steps: If your puff pastry starts to get too warm while you’re working, pop it back in the fridge for a few minutes to keep it manageable.
- Experiment with Flavors: Try swapping out the Nutella for other spreads, like almond butter, or even fruit preserves for a unique twist.
Storing and Reheating Tips:
To keep your Nutella Puff Pastries fresh, store any leftovers in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days. If you want to store them longer, consider placing them in the fridge for about a week. To reheat, simply pop them in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 5-7 minutes until warm.
